Ingredients

Main Ingredients

- 2 boneless, skinless chicken breasts

- 1 tablespoon olive oil

- 1 teaspoon cumin

- 1 teaspoon chili powder

- Salt and pepper to taste

- 1 cup quinoa, rinsed

- 2 cups water or chicken broth

- 1 can black beans, rinsed and drained

- 1 medium avocado, diced

- 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ved

- 1/2 cup corn (fresh or frozen)

- 1/4 cup fresh cilantro, chopped

- 1 lime, juiced

- 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der

Optional Toppings

- Greek yogurt or sour cream

- Shredded cheese

- Hot sauce

Step-by-Step Instructions

Preparing the Chicken

To start, I preheat my oven to 400°F (200°C). In a small bowl, I mix one tablespoon of olive oil, one teaspoon of cumin, one teaspoon of chili powder, salt, and pepper. This mix makes a tasty marinade for our chicken. I coat the two chicken breasts with the marinade and place them in an oven-safe dish. I bake the chicken for 20 to 25 minutes. I check that the internal temperature hits 165°F (74°C). Once cooked, I let the chicken rest for five minutes before slicing it.

Cooking the Quinoa

While the chicken is baking, I focus on cooking the quinoa. I grab a medium saucepan and combine one cup of rinsed quinoa with two cups of water or chicken broth. I bring it to a boil, then reduce the heat. I cover the pan and let it simmer for about 15 minutes. The quinoa is ready when the liquid is absorbed. I fluff it with a fork to keep it light.

Assembling the Burrito Bowl

Next, I take a large bowl and mix the cooked quinoa with one can of rinsed black beans, one diced avocado, one cup of halved cherry tomatoes, and half a cup of corn. I add a quarter cup of chopped cilantro, the juice from one lime, and half a teaspoon of garlic powder. I gently mix everything together. To build my burrito bowl, I place a generous amount of the quinoa mixture at the bottom of a bowl. I top it with the sliced baked chicken. For extra flavor, I add toppings like Greek yogurt, shredded cheese, or hot sauce. This makes for a colorful and tasty meal!

Tips & Tricks

Perfectly Cooked Chicken

To get the best chicken, use boneless, skinless breasts. Marinate them with olive oil, cumin, chili powder, salt, and pepper. This adds flavor. Bake them at 400°F for 20-25 minutes. Check the internal temperature; it should be 165°F. After baking, let the chicken rest for five minutes. This keeps it juicy. Slice it thinly for topping the bowl.

Fluffy Quinoa Every Time

For fluffy quinoa, rinse it first to remove bitterness. Use one cup of quinoa and two cups of water or chicken broth. Bring the mixture to a boil and then lower the heat. Cover the pot and let it simmer for about 15 minutes. Once the liquid is gone, fluff the quinoa with a fork. This ensures each grain is separate and light.

Variations

Vegetarian Alternative

To make a tasty vegetarian version, swap the chicken for grilled tofu or tempeh. Both options soak up flavors well and add protein. Use the same marinade to coat the tofu or tempeh before grilling. This keeps the dish vibrant and full of flavor. You can even add extra veggies like bell peppers or zucchini for added texture.

Grain-Free Option

If you prefer a grain-free dish, try using cauliflower rice instead of quinoa. Simply pulse cauliflower florets in a food processor until they resemble rice. Sauté the cauliflower with a bit of olive oil and seasoning for added flavor. This option is low in carbs and high in nutrients, making it a great choice for many diets.

Storage Info

How to Store Leftovers

Store any leftover Chicken Avocado Burrito Bowl in an airtight container. Make sure to cool it to room temperature first. Place it in the fridge where it will last up to four days. If you have toppings like avocado, add those fresh when serving.

Reheating Tips

To reheat, use the microwave for quick warming. Place the bowl in for about 1-2 minutes. Stir halfway to heat evenly. If you prefer, you can also reheat on the stove. Just add a splash of water in a pan over low heat. Stir gently until warmed through.

Freezing Guidelines

You can freeze the chicken and quinoa mix for later use. Store them in a freezer-safe container. They will be good for up to three months. Avoid freezing fresh toppings like avocado or tomatoes as they do not thaw well. When ready to eat, th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ating.

FAQs

Can I use brown rice instead of quinoa?

Yes, you can use brown rice in place of quinoa. Brown rice adds a nice chewy texture. It also has a nutty flavor. Just remember, brown rice takes longer to cook. You will need about 40 to 50 minutes to prepare it. Use two cups of water for each cup of rice.

What can I substitute for chicken if I'm vegetarian?

For a vegetarian option, use black beans or grilled veggies. Tofu or tempeh also works well. Both add protein and flavor. You can season them just like the chicken for great taste.

How long does the Chicken Avocado Burrito Bowl last in the fridge?

The Chicken Avocado Burrito Bowl can last for up to four days in the fridge. Keep it in an airtight container to maintain freshness. If you store it correctly, it will taste great even after a few days.
